Output 224faaeafcaa874ec875bb9a6f1f8ca895aa984c7d1c72c99f0bd6567fc1a698:1

value
24748427
script pubkey
OP_0 OP_PUSHBYTES_20 e0659e433d1f6940610e81d6b183bf8611f9d76a
address
bc1qupjeuseara55qcgws8ttrqalscgln4m2lrzjqx
transaction
224faaeafcaa874ec875bb9a6f1f8ca895aa984c7d1c72c99f0bd6567fc1a698
spent
true